The ceremony of naming the Chemical Auditorium after Professor Jacek Namieśnik took place on 12 April 2024.

During the ceremony, the Rector of Gdańsk University of Technology, prof. Krzysztof Wilde, PhD Eng., corresponding member of the PAS gave his speech, and the laudation was delivered by the Dean of the Faculty of Chemistry, prof. Agata Kot-Wasik, PhD, Eng. After the ceremonial uncovering of the commemorative plaque, the guests could enjoy the performance of the Academic Choir of Gdańsk University of Technology under the direction of prof. Mariusz Mróz, PhD, DSc.

The next point of the program was a scientific seminar entitled "Analyst – quo vadis?" during which the following scientists gave their speeches:

  • prof. Piotr Stepnowski, PhD, DSc, corresponding member of the PAS, Rector of the University of Gdańsk - "Pharma(e)cological analysis";
  • prof. Michał Markuszewski, PhD, DSc, Vice-Rector for Science, Medical University of Gdańsk - "Metabolomics in bioanalytics: current state and future trends";
  • prof. Piotr Konieczka, PhD, DSc, Eng., Head of the Department of Analytical Chemistry, Faculty of Chemistry, Gdańsk University of Technology - "Less and less, or where is the limit of trace analysis?".

At the end, the guests took the floor, and the Dean read some of the letters sent by those who could not participate in the event in person.
